Malawi Visa

Visa means an endorsement or an entry in a passport or other travel document made by an immigration officer or any official of the government authorized to do so to indicate that the bearer thereof has been granted permission to enter or er-enter the country concerned. A visa in Malawi […]

Malawi Visa | Documents required